What companies run services between Luton, England and Scunthorpe, England?

You can take a train from Luton to Scunthorpe via London St Pancras International, King's Cross, and Doncaster in around 3h 18m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Luton DART Parkway to Doncaster Frenchgate Interchange once daily. Tickets cost £13–22 and the journey takes 3h 50m.
